Abstract: The present invention relates to a process for production of fossil free hydrocarbons from lignocellulosic material comprising the steps of: A-hydrolyzing the lignocellulosic material using ammonium bisulfite, whereby the conditions of the hydrolysis are being controlled by regulating pH, temperature, color, pressure, sulfite content, kappa number and/or R18, such that a desired product can be obtained for further processing of the hydrolyzed material. B-hydrothermal carbonizing the hydrolyzed material that is not further processed using hydrothermal liquefaction (HTL) or hydrothermal carbonization (HTC) to produce at least biooil. C-separating liquids and gases from prior process steps for cleaning and reuse of liquid, gases and chemicals contained therein. D-generating electricity and/or steam to perform the steps of the process by using liquid, gas, biooil or bio-coal produced in the prior process steps, to operate at least a part of the steps of the process.
